A highly compact and lightweight camcorder, the SDR-S71 improves upon its predecessor the SDR-S50 by offering dedicated SD Card recording. SD Cards are readily available, fast and inexpensive, and accessible by nearly all modern computers for home video editing. The SDR-S71 also includes special features that allow you to produce high-quality movies with ease.

One of the highlights of the SDR-S71’s design is its powerful 70x optical zoom. Of course, with such a great zoom range, handshake becomes an issue. That’s why Advanced O.I.S. handshake stabilisation is included to give you a better image. Couple this with a 33mm (35mm equivalent) wide-angle lens, iA focus technology and wind-noise cancellation, and you’ve got yourself a pretty powerful pocket DVC. In addition, the included software makes sharing your videos with your friends quick and easy. The SDR-S71 is an all-round performer.

Who knew that HD cameras could get this tiny? And 3D-capable, to boot? The HDC-SD900 is one of Panasonic’s most recent additions to the burgeoning field consumer HD camcorders. Boasting Panasonic’s high-sensitivity 3MOS image system, this little machine packs 11.49 million effective motion image pixels of excellence into its slender frame. What’s more, it uses SD cards!

Most interesting is the HDC-SD900’s ability to produce dynamic 3D content. With the optional VW-CLT1 3D conversion lens, you can produce high-definition 3D video on-the-fly, ready to play back on your 3D-capable TV system. Also featuring Panasonic’s iA image enhancement technology, a 3.5″ LCD touchscreen and HYBRID O.I.S. image stabiliser, the HDC-SD900 is hard to beat.

The advent of digital

We are presently living in a highly digital world – much of our technology has some kind of digital component, being computer controlled and readily connected to different devices. The effect of digital technology has been extremely visible in the realm of photography, with digital cameras now in the vast majority of homes.
Indeed, traditional ‘analogue’ or film photography has seriously diminished over the past decade. It is becoming more and more difficult to find places that are willing to process or even sell 35mm film. The only remnants of the ‘old world’ of photography are the disposable cameras frequently taken on school trips and for photos with a ‘retro charm’. Still, there is a dedicated following for film photography, and it still plays a large part in the educational and artistic markets.

The greatest advantage of digital photography is its versatility. Digital cameras can take many more photos than traditional film-based cameras, photo which can later be edited using a computer program such as Photoshop. Photos can now be made perfect using simple but very powerful tools. In addition, they can be shared with family and friends using the internet, or displayed continuously in digital photo frames. Digital technology offers innumerable possibilities, enhancing creativity, communication and practicality.

Technology has progressed considerably since the days of the Super-8 camera, or even the humble Handycam. Full High-Definition (HD) video is now a reality, and is even included on several still cameras. Film and tape are no longer the media of choice, as hard disks, DVDs and flash memory provide greater storage and generally higher quality. Videos are now transferred digitally to computers where they can be edited in a non-linear fashion and kept safely on disk. The speed of the FireWire/IEEE 1394 interface means that video transfer is faster than ever.

Modern digital video cameras are exceptionally easy to use – it’s generally a case of ‘point and shoot’, and your memories are instantly recorded. A tripod is a very useful addition, especially with the advent of ‘video blogs’ where your thoughts are recorded, for example, during your travels, and posted online. Nikon has been producing high quality cameras since 1917 and has become one of, if not the most well known camera manufacturers in the world. The quality of their product, combined with their forward thinking, has produced a brand recognition that is unsurpassed in the camera industry.

Forward Compatible

Nikon knew the value of producing a quality product even ninety years ago. They also knew that by producing products that would be forward compatible for years to come, they would gain the faith of their customers. Consumers that purchased a Nikon SLR camera twenty years ago and now have purchased a new digital camera, such as the Nikon D3000, have the confidence in knowing that the expensive Nikkor or Nikon lenses are compatible with the newer SLR cameras (while used in Manual mode).

The Legria FS200 is Canon’s smallest, most stylish Standard Definition digital video camera ever. This video camera is packed with 41x zoom, high quality sensor and photos, Quick Start, Quick Charge Intelligent lithium battery, microphone socket and all the great benefits of a camera that will last into the future. It’s great to take away, to the kid’s footy match, or simply to have - capturing the exciting moments in life. Let’s look at some of the specifications of this brand new digicam

  • Records over 3 hours in highest quality video to a 16GB SDHC card
  • Encorporates a Canon lens with 41x Advanced zoom
  • 800k Sensor & DiG!C DV II Processor
  • Large 2.7 inch LCD display that includes backlight and brightness controls
  • Real Widescreen is standard
  • Quick Start via LCD display for instant recording and power save
  • The Canon Legria FS200 promotes ease of use, combined with fantastic quality imaging. The video camera comes with a Battery Pack, Power Adapter, USB 2.0 Hi Speed, Solution Disk DVSD V30.0, Pixela ImageMixer 3.SE and a remote control.
